I have only had 1 700mm barrel inn all my dawdling with air guns. Proved too long. I can get all the power I want out of a 600mm when shooting slugs. However, I don’t shoot the heavy for caliber slugs and that is where the 700 shines.

Griffin .22 ldc 17g slugs?

In fact I had a notos with a 380mm superior, from 730fps to 840 they shot well enough to take 100s of souls.
After I slapped on a 600mm they tightened further. Out of the 600 from 850-900 they shot just as well as jsb pellets. About 1.3moa at 100 if I had the gun on a lead sled. Frequently plucked squirrels out of trees 65-93y from my elevated perch at my preferred hunt. I don't foresee disappointing results. Start shooting them at 870 and work up. Every barrel is unique.

Skout  Why do Skout use Poly O rings?

Skout needs to do both Buna N & Polyurethane O-rings. There is no doubt that poly is better in some applications…….AND there is even no less doubt that Buna N is better in a lot of applications. A PCP can utilize both in the same gun. That’s my .02.

Again, my opionion here; Skout used poly previously and they are not only accustomed to such seals but that’s what they had in paid for stock and available. Now, with PCPs please diversify your seal use portfolio 😊
I agree. In the applications where a constant high pressure is present, the PU orings can tend to take a “set” like the SK-OU9009 in the HP regulator. We shifted that to 90 duro Buna N over a year ago, and recently Skout has installed a 70 duro Buna N X ring in that position.

That is one of my pet peeves I never let go. You are selling RSC's (residential security containers) as safes, they are not safes by industry definition. there is no grey area. Safes have UL ratings, UL has an RSC rating and it is a joke, basically nobody get's there RSC's certified by UL for the simple fact they can't even pass that low bar. Same goes for advertised fire ratings, if it isn't cerified, it isn't worth a damn. I own 3 RSC's myself, not that I am against them, just be honest about it. I do own one real tl-15 fire rated safe, smaller than my smallest RSC, and weighs a few hundred pounds more than my biggest RSC.
